
Russia & US in Talks on Cooperation in Arctic, Alaska: Putin
In a recent statement, Russian President Vladimir Putin revealed that Russia and the United States are engaging in discussions to collaborate on projects in Russia’s Arctic zone and the US state of Alaska. This development has significant implications for the global energy landscape, as it could lead to the sharing of cutting-edge technologies and expertise in the exploration and extraction of natural resources.
Speaking at a meeting with Russian energy industry executives, Putin highlighted the unique capabilities that Russia possesses in the area of Arctic exploration and extraction. “The technologies that we possess, today no one but us possesses…This is of interest to our partners, including those from the US,” he said.
One of the key companies involved in Russia’s Arctic energy initiatives is Novatek, the country’s largest liquefied natural gas (LNG) producer. Novatek is already operating in the Arctic region, and its expertise in this area is likely to be a key factor in any potential cooperation with the US.
